Noph or Moph was the Hebrew name for the ancient … WitrynaThe Codex Alexandrinus is certainly one of the oldest Bibles in history. It is a total of 773 pages, and a full reproduction of the Bible is available on the website of the British Library. The pages are made of vellum, and it is hand-written. Because of the delicate nature of the Codex Alexandrinus, it is rarely touched. WitrynaKemet. 25 May Israelite Slavery In America: The Origin of Africans In America.
